Strike disrupts normal life in Manipur

Imphal, August 03 : Normal life was disrupted here Wednesday in response to a 12-hour strike called by the All Manipur Students’Union (AMSU) to protest the bomb blast on the outskirts of the state capital in Imphal West district.

Official sources said all transport services between Manipur and rest of neighbouring states were cancelled because of the strike which began at 5 am.

The strike exempted media and essential services like medical and water supply.

Fatwa allows fasting men to use nicotine patches

Dubai, August 03: A special fatwa issued by a religious body here has permitted smokers to use of nicotine patches during the month of Ramadan to deal with withdrawal symptoms, saying it does not violate the observance of fasting.

The Islamic Affairs and Charitable Activities Department (IACAD) here issues list of fatwas daily to help Muslims observe their fast in the right manner during Ramadan.

“Nicotine patches, which can help smokers to deal with their withdrawal symptoms during the day, are permitted,” the fatwa said.

Taliban suicide bomber kills 4 in Afghanistan

Kabul, August 03: A suicide bomber blew up his car outside a compound frequented by foreigners in northern Afghanistan on Tuesday, killing four guards, as two other militants stormed the building and battled Afghan police.

The Taliban claimed responsibility for the assault in Kunduz city, the latest in a rising number of attacks in northern Afghanistan.

The blast damaged several buildings nearby, and flames could be seen shooting up an exterior wall. Shattered glass and a severed leg lay on the ground, while other body parts had been collected and tied up in a blanket.

Activist Teesta Setalvad gets anticipatory bail

Ahmedabad, August 03: Social activist Teesta Setalvad of the Citizens for Justice and Peace was Tuesday granted anticipatory bail by a court here in a criminal case filed against her by a former aide Rais Khan, a lawyer said.

Additional Sessions Judge S.B. Gajera granted her plea for anticipatory bail with the condition that in the eventuality of facing arrest she may deposit Rs.25,000 and avail the bail, said S.M. Vohra, her lawyer.

Setalvad filed the application over Khan’s allegation that she had fabricated evidence in connection with the 2002 Gujarat riots.

At least 22 people died during clinical trials of drugs

New Delhi, August 03: At least 22 people lost their lives last year during clinical trials for drugs and cosmetics in the country, the Rajya Sabha was informed on Tuesday.

“As per information made available by the sponsors/Clinical Research Organisations, compensation has been paid in 22 cases of trial related deaths which occurred in 2010,” Health Minister Ghulam Nabi Azad said in reply to a written question on the matter.

Nine travellers lynched to death near Bangalore

Bangalore, August 03: In two separate horrific incidents in Karnataka, nine travellers from India’s tech capital of Bangalore were lynched to death by villagers who were suspicious of their movements.

In the first case, eight people were thrashed by villagers on their visit to Errakote, which is 10 kms from Chintamani taluk in Chikaballapur. The villagers apparently grew suspicious of the visitors’ movements and beat them up.

Six of the eight travellers died and two others are undergoing treatment at Bangalore’s Nimhans hospital.

Aiming for size zero

Mumbai, August 03: It seems Sonam Kapoor is aiming for size zero. The already slim actress has now joined Bikram Yoga classes, where she is expected to sweat it out and burn oodles of calories.

“Starting bikram yoga today or as everyone calls it hot yoga. It’s my dads secret for looking fab. (sic), ” Sonam posted on her Twitter page.

Bikram Yoga is a distinct style developed by yoga guru Bikram Choudhury who holds a US copyright on his yoga that comprises 26 ‘asanas’ or postures and two breathing exercises.
